Overview

CVE-2024-44674 is a medium-severity vulnerability affecting dlink covr-2600r_firmware. It was published on October 7, 2024 and has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 5.7 (MEDIUM).

This vulnerability has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 5.7, rated MEDIUM. It requires local or adjacent network access to exploit. Some level of privileges is required for exploitation.

Technical Description

D-Link COVR-2600R FW101b05 is vulnerable to Buffer Overflow. In the function sub_24E28, the HTTP_REFERER is obtained through an environment variable, and this field is controllable, allowing it to be used as the value for src.
